How to read or write Arabic without harakat? I can only read arabic with harakat or vowel marks and I can only write arabic with latin alphabet ? :"D

To be able to read it without Harakat you should know the similar words which are similar without Harakat to know the possibilities of the right meaning that the writer mean for this word without Harakat, then you can know the exactly right meaning from the context.. it might take a while but it's important to read and write without Harakat also you'll know many words in fast way

Arabic is one of the easiest languages to read as it is pronounced nearly as it is written with very few exceptions. You will be able after sometime to read it without harakat especially when you get familiar with many Arabic words and the basic structure of the sentences . Imagine a native English speaker reading "y r my bst frnd "
